Leading the week
Monday (February 17): Marco Rubio continues Middle East visit; 500th day in captivity for remaining Israeli hostages; Candidates’ debate ahead of German election.
Tuesday (February 18): Hearing in challenge to Trump administration’s transgender military ban; Marco Rubio concludes Middle East visit; Chinese Foreign Minister Wang Yi chairs UN Security Council debate on multilateralism.
Wednesday (February 19): Donald Trump expected at FII PRIORITY Miami event alongside TikTok CEO; Rescheduled confirmation hearing for Labor Secretary nominee Lori Chavez-DeRemer; Candidates’ debate ahead of German election.
Thursday (February 20): CPAC begins; South Africa hosts two-day G20 foreign ministers’ meeting boycotted by Marco Rubio; Final candidates’ debate ahead of German election.
Friday (February 21): CPAC continues with Ronald Reagan Dinner; Hearing in state case against Luigi Mangione; DC Mayor Muriel Bowser speaks at the National Press Club.
Saturday (February 22): Final day of CPAC; Further hostages due to be released under Israel-Hamas agreement.
Sunday (February 23): German elections; Public funeral ceremony for former Hezbollah leader Hassan Nasrallah; Screen Actors Guild Awards.
